Why do they ask this question?

It seems pretty straightforward; you would not have applied to this position if you were not interested in it, so why do hiring managers ask this question?

Well, there are a few reasons. Firstly they want to make sure you are not just interested in the salary you would receive. Interviewers like to know that you have some loyalty to the company and would not leave if you received a better offer elsewhere. Lastly, they want to know that you are capable of doing the job they require and understand the value of this position.

Things to avoid

The issue with straightforward questions such as this one is that it is easy to give generic answers. The majority of people will do this, and whilst these answers are fine, they will not make you stand out. Another aspect to avoid is the perks of the job. Discussing things like vacation days may give the hiring manager the wrong impression of why you want to work for them.

Answering Methods

Experts across the globe will argue about the different ways to answer this question, but overall, it falls on personal preference. You should select the method that feels most genuine to your own interview style but keep in mind the type of job you are applying for. Emotive answers will not hold up well in the stock market sector but can be perfect when applying to care roles.

Connection Story Method

A connection story is something that links you directly to the company you are interviewing for; this can be their products, services, or even company culture. By starting your answer with the link you have to the company, your answer will sound more personalized and show you have done your research before your interview.

An emotional connection is key for this part of your answer. Pick things you admire or respect about this company in comparison to other companies within the field (do not name those companies!). Your main aim by using this method is to portray that you understand the company and why it exists.

Example Answer

“I’ve been using this company for the past five years, and every time I enter the establishment, I am greeted with friendly people who show a genuine interest in me as a customer. It feels like I am part of a community. I enjoy using your services and feel like I am in good hands. This is the sort of organization I would like to be a part of so I too can offer people the great service that has been offered to me by your company.”

Complimentary Method

For this method, you need to break down your answer into three parts whilst complimenting the company throughout. Firstly, you want to mention that your own skills and qualities fit those of the job description. This tells potential employers that you will be up and running within a role quickly. Also, it shows you understand what the position entails.

The next aspect you should mention is how you plan to stay in the role for a long period. When companies invest in your training, they want to know that this investment will payout, and you will remain within the company for the long term. Mentioning how you would like to grow within the company will help you stand out from other applicants.

Emphasize teamwork…

Finally, you should mention the team you would be working with. Praising the company’s choice of employees and mentioning positive traits they possess will show the interviewer how well you would fit in with their current team. Make sure to add genuine compliments about the company throughout.

Example Answer

“I am interested in this position for a number of reasons. I believe that the skills and qualities you listed in the job description fit those I have myself, which will allow me to perform highly in this role. Secondly, I am looking for long-term employment and a company I can grow in.

Having researched your company, I believe you have very high standards and offer excellent services to customers, which is an ethos I would like to be part of. Lastly, I think it is very clear that you hire ambitious and enthusiastic people. I think it is really important to be surrounded by positive people that will encourage me to continue to grow as an individual and as part of a working team.”

Qualification Method

Using this method, you are going to link your previous experience to the role you are applying for. This will demonstrate your research skills and your enthusiasm. First of all, consider specific situations you have previously dealt with and select ones that represent what you can do for this company.

The key is to be specific and relevant but also portray your enthusiasm during that situation. If you do not have a specific example from your previous positions, talk about the steps you have taken to lead up to this opportunity and how they have prepared you for taking the next step.

Display enthusiasm…

You should list the key qualities you want the interviewer to know about you and why this qualifies you for the role. Next, you should research the company and drop your knowledge about them into your answer. Consider why you do want to work for them, are they industry leaders? Do they treat their employees well? Are their teams diverse?

Finally, bring your enthusiasm. Tell them why you are excited about the position and why you enjoyed completing the projects you previously mentioned. Remember, it is not just your words that are important here; display your enthusiasm in your face and body language.

Example Answer

“I know this position will require me to manage the company’s marketing campaigns. In my previous position, I handled the organization’s digital marketing. During my time there, I increased the traffic to our website by 40% and subsequently increased our customer base.

I really enjoyed this part of my role and would be excited to continue working with these platforms. I am also excited that you are an innovative company and are not afraid to try new things. This is important to me as I enjoy taking on new challenges.”
